How much do Industrial Engineering Technologists and Technicians make in Minnesota?
The median Industrial Engineering Technologists and Technicians in Minnesota earns $70,490 per year (BLS May 2025), about $33.89 per hour.
What is that after taxes?
$70,490 gross in Minnesota keeps $55,150 after federal income tax ($6,678), FICA ($5,392) and state income tax ($3,270) — $4,596 per month, a 78.2% keep-rate.
How does Minnesota compare to the national median for Industrial Engineering Technologists and Technicians?
The Minnesota median is $4,370 above the national median of $66,120.
